Enhanced In‐Plane Omnidirectional Energy Harvesting from Extremely Weak Magnetic Fields via Fourfold Symmetric Magneto‐Mechano‐Electric Coupling

Abstract:Magneto‐mechano‐electric (MME) energy harvesters (EHs) have emerged as a promising solution for powering Internet of Things (IoT) sensor networks by capturing ambient stray magnetic fields in urban circumstance. Despite significant advancements, achieving milliwatt‐level power generation from extremely weak (<1 Oe) and randomly oriented magnetic fields remains challenging.
